<u>We are given the equation:</u>
(a + b)! = a! + b!
<u>Testing the given equation</u>
In order to test it, we will let: a = 2 and b = 3
So, we can rewrite the equation as:
(2+3)! = 2! + 3!
5! = 2! + 3!
<em>We know that (5! = 120) , (2! = 2) and (3! = 6):</em>
120 = 2 + 6
We can see that LHS ≠ RHS,
So, we can say that the given equation is incorrect

Answer:
it will take 1.4 hours for the two trains to be 294 miles apart
Step-by-step explanation:
Let t be the time taken for each train
The westbound train travels at 95 miles per hour.
Speed of westbound train = 95
time = t
Distance = speed * time = 95 t
The eastbound train travels at 115 miles per hour
Speed of eastbound train = 115
time = t
Distance = speed * time = 115 t
both trains are 294 miles apart means the distance between both trains are 294 miles
So we add the distance of both trains and set it equal to 294
95t + 115t = 294
210 t =294
t = 1.4
So, it will take 1.4 hours for the two trains to be 294 miles apart
